Average Animal Caretakers Salary in Binghamton, NY
The average salary for a Animal Caretakers in Binghamton, NY is $34,340. This compensation is in line with national standards, reflecting a balanced and stable local job market.

Methodology: Salary data is derived from the Bureau of Labor Statistics (BLS) OEWS 2024 release. Figures represent gross pay before taxes. Analysis includes 130 employees in the Binghamton, NY area with a job density of 1.31 per 1,000 jobs. Cost of Living data is estimated based on state and metro averages.
